2nd Lesson - Greek Steps
I have altered the steps at the top of my painting to virtually disappear around the corner. This will help add depth. For the steps I used Cobalt, Cadmium Red, Indian Red and Cadmium Yellow Deep. There is not a lot of detail at this stage and I have feathered off any hard edges with a mix of Cobalt and Cadmium Red. These 2 colours make a dirty purple which is what we want at this stage. The Indian Red was used for the doorway and window shutters. The main aim here is just to keep it very soft, adding more detail and colour as we proceed down the canvas. Don't forget to keep darks dark even though we want them out-of-focus.
